International Business Machines Corp. (NYSE:IBM) Director Michael L. Eskew sold 4,000 shares of the company’s stock in a transaction that occurred on Thursday, August 21st. The stock was sold at an average price of $191.90, for a total transaction of $767,600.00. The sale was disclosed in a legal fil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. A few weeks back, Apple (AAPL) and International Business Machines Corporation (NYSE:IBM) entered into a partnership in which IBM would be able to analyze the data collected from Apple’s devices. The purpose of the partnership is to create 100 mobile apps specifically for enterprise customers.
